Output 81868f6b0ebb85a25aabc39005c1948dc14d2d55a4e6fed65fe7346615b56da8:1

value
965387268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3f2f6076791fcc59a8ef1baa04f6a963bc58fc7 OP_EQUAL
address
3NUJNKTML4iMnLcw5BVRmxBX1PLYJFYVmv
transaction
81868f6b0ebb85a25aabc39005c1948dc14d2d55a4e6fed65fe7346615b56da8
confirmations
385337
spent
true